C语言递归函数是编程中一个强大的工具,通过学习其实例和应用场景,能够更好地理解和掌握这一编程技术。首先,让我们深入分析一个实例,比如使用递归计算阶乘。在这个例子中,递归函数通过不断调用自身,并将问题分解为规模较小的子问题,最终实现了整体的阶乘计算。此外,递归还可以应用于树形结构的问题,如树的遍历。通过递归的方式,我们可以简洁而高效地完成对树中节点的访问。对于初学者来说,理解递归的应用场景和实例有助于提高编程能力,使得解决问题的思路更为灵活。在实际项目中,递归函数也常常用于解决复杂的逻辑问题,对于编写清晰且易维护的代码具有积极作用。